What is Soffit?
Soffit describes the material that covers the underside of architectural features such as eaves, arches, and overhangs. Its main function is to supply a finished look while likewise securing the structural components from the aspects.

Cladding describes the exterior material applied to buildings to supply thermal insulation, weather condition security, and aesthetic enhancement. Cladding materials can be set up over numerous structural substrates, improving a structure's performance and look.

Boosted Aesthetic Value
Both soffit and cladding improve the curb appeal of a home. They offer endless style possibilities and can match various architectural styles.
2. Weather condition Protection
These elements secure the underlying structures from environmental damage. Soffits assist avoid rot and wear Fascia And Soffit Specialists tear, while cladding acts as a shield against moisture and temperature level changes.
3. Improved Energy Efficiency
By integrating insulation products with cladding, property owners can lower energy expenses by lessening heat loss in winter season and heat gain in summer.
4. Increased Property Value
Investing in quality soffit and cladding can increase the value of a property. Possible purchasers frequently think about the aesthetic appeals and maintenance of exterior materials when making getting decisions.
5. Low Maintenance Options
Modern soffit and cladding materials, such as aluminum and vinyl, require very little upkeep, making them appropriate for busy house owners or commercial residential or commercial property supervisors.
